The Central Bank of Turkmenistan issued sets of commemorative golden and silver coins on State Flag Day, the Ashgabat correspondent of Turkmenistan.ru reports. Each set consists of 3 coins, each worth Manat 1000. Silver coins with the diameter of 38,61 mm and the weight of 28,28 gram were made of silver of the 925 standard. Their golden analogues (916,7 standard) weight 39,94 gram with the same diameter.
